Hi! It seems that most Turbine (at least 2.x versions, I don't know about version 3) applications won't work with a recent JBoss, such as 3.0.4. This is due to JBoss using a new Jetty version as its web container; the new version splits request URI in a different way than it used to.
Quoting Greg Wilkins from message http://groups.yahoo.com/group/jetty-support/message/4470: ---- unfortunatley Jetty had to change getRequestURL (back in June) to comply with the servlet spec. requestURI == contextPath + servletPath + pathInfo is always true (as required in SRV.4.4) ---- Is there something that the Turbine 2.x developers could do to make Turbine work with SRV.4.4 compliant web containers?
